About the Role

The Onboarding Specialist serves as the dedicated guide and advocate for all new clinical hires during their onboarding and transition-to-practice journey. The Onboarding Specialist liaises with Corporate departments, Operational Leaders, and the Transition to Practice Program to ensure that new clinicians are fully supported from time of hire, integrated, and equipped to thrive within the organization.

By proactively identifying barriers, problem-solving challenges, and serving as a liaison with key stakeholders across the organization, the Onboarding Specialist plays a pivotal role in optimizing the new hire experience and strengthening long-term clinician retention.

Duties & Responsibilities

Onboarding & Integration

• Serve as a resource and concierge for all new clinical hires at time of hire

• Guide new hires through organizational processes, resources, and support structures to ensure seamless integration.

• Monitor and track onboarding milestones, ensuring timely completion and addressing gaps or concerns.

Retention & Engagement

• Actively monitor new hire satisfaction and engagement levels, identifying potential barriers to success or retention.

• Partner with HR and Clinical Leadership to provide early intervention and solutions

• Facilitate connections between new hires

Collaboration & Communication

• Serve as a liaison between new clinicians and departments such as Operations, HR, Clinical Education, Data Integrity, and IT to resolve barriers.

• Communicate progress, insights, and emerging themes to the Director of Clinician Experience.

• Contribute to continuous improvement initiatives by gathering feedback and identifying opportunities to enhance the clinician experience.
